Gislason & Hunter LLP Remains Fully Operational During Shelter in Place

March 26, 2020

(March 26, 2020) – Gislason & Hunter LLP will continue to work remote and be fully operational after yesterday’s announcement from Minnesota Governor Tim Walz where he issued an Executive Order which directs Minnesotans to stay home. The “Shelter in Place” order takes effect beginning this Friday, March 27, 2020 at 11:59 pm. and ends on Friday, April 10, 2020 at 5:00 pm. The order limits activity for all those not engaged in “Critical Sector”.

The firm has proactively taken this precautionary measure to help slow the spread of the COVID-19 virus, and protect the health and safety of their personnel, clients and the communities in which the live and work. A proactive approach with technology and the cloud has given Gislason & Hunter the ability to remain fully operational yet ensuring people are safe. Attorneys and staff have been working remotely since March 17, 2020.
